11-6-4
Section 11-6-4 State participation in salary. When any county has established the office of
county engineer or chief engineer of the division of public roads the Director of the Department
of Transportation shall, upon application of the county commission, authorize the expenditure
out of the available funds of the State Department of Transportation, of an amount equal to
70 percent of the annual salary of the engineer to such county, which shall apply to the payment
of the annual salary of the engineer, with such payments to be made in equal monthly installments;
provided, that the amount contributed or paid by the State Department of Transportation to
any county, not including retirement contributions, shall not exceed 70 percent of step 18,
or the top step, whichever is greater, of the salary schedule under the Professional Civil
Engineer II, Senior classification in any one year. (Acts 1971, No. 1945, p. 3143, §5; Act
2019-2, 1st Sp. Sess., §3.)...

34-21A-6
Section 34-21A-6 Funding and financial administration of the board. (a) There is hereby established
a separate special fund in the State Treasury to be known as the "Alabama Onsite Wastewater
Board Fund." All receipts and monies collected under this chapter shall be deposited
in the fund and used only to carry out the provisions of this chapter. The fund shall be disbursed
only by warrant of the state Comptroller upon the State Treasury upon itemized vouchers approved
by the executive director. No funds shall be withdrawn or expended except as budgeted and
allotted according to Sections 41-4-80 to 41-4-96, inclusive, and 41-19-1 to 41-19-12, inclusive,
and only in amounts as stipulated in the general appropriation bill or other appropriation
bills. (b) Any funds unspent and unencumbered at the end of each fiscal year that exceed 25
percent of the board's budget for the previous fiscal year shall be transferred to the State
General Fund. (Act 99-571, p. 1265, §6.)...
